Peyton was originally an English surname derived from a place name meaning "Pœga's town". Pœga is an Old English name of unknown meaning.
The previously masculine Peyton, came into use as a girl's name after the character Peyton, played by actress Rebecca DeMornay, in the 1992 film "The Hand That Rocks The Cradle."
